What is a limitation of solar energy?

Explanation:
Solar energy generation depends on sunlight, so its output varies with time of day and weather. On cloudy days or at night, the amount of light reaching solar panels drops significantly or disappears, causing electricity production to fall or stop unless energy storage or another power source is available. This variability and need for backup is the main practical limitation, shaping how solar is integrated into the grid and how storage or flexible generation is used to maintain a steady supply. It’s not true that solar energy never requires maintenance—panels and inverters need periodic cleaning, inspection, and sometimes replacement of components. And solar energy doesn’t emit greenhouse gases during operation; its life-cycle emissions are generally low, and it certainly doesn’t produce radioactive waste.
